Get to Know Leadership Triangle

The Triangle area has a bright future.

Our forward-looking community exudes promise and energy from every corner.

To live up to this promise, we need leaders to step up, build a cohesive vision for the region as a whole, and make our potential a reality for all.

Leadership Triangle exists to train these leaders and connect them into a strong network with a shared vision, intent upon seeing each other succeed.

Over the last 30 years, 1,000+ Triangle leaders have completed our programs, building positive momentum and community impact. And we’re just getting started.

OUR MISSION

To educate, develop, connect and activate leaders committed to making the Triangle the best place to work, live and thrive.

OUR VISION

We envision that all residents of the Triangle enjoy the highest quality of life for themselves and future generations.

OUR VALUES

Self-awareness | Interdependence | Equity | Transformation


Self-awareness: We believe we can’t lead without first knowing who we are – our strengths, our biases, and our blind spots. Self-awareness is the foundation of emotional intelligence and the bedrock of leadership. 


Interdependence: We believe in creating right relationship between individuals, systems and our environment. Our success and well-being depends on the success and well-being of every person, organization, and community within the Triangle. 


Equity: We recognize that, along all spectrums of identity, systems have been designed to create harm for some and benefit for others. We work to correct these imbalances and ultimately, see justice and liberation realized for our full community.  


Transformation: Change is constant; we believe that there is always room for personal growth and progress in our region. 

The challenges of our communities do not lie neatly within city or county boundaries.

The Triangle’s quality of life and future growth depends on our ability to work across these boundaries to find common ground.

Kristine Sloan

Kristine Sloan

Executive Director

A Triangle native, Kristine brings a deep commitment to justice, interdependence, and authenticity into all of the work that she does. She’s an entrepreneur, organizational leader, facilitator and strategist. Prior to joining Leadership Triangle, Kristine was the CEO of StartingBloc, a global leadership development nonprofit supporting 3200+ entrepreneurs, activists, organizational leaders and organizers in amplifying their impact.

Prior to StartingBloc, she led a multimillion dollar grant project in Burundi for All Across Africa, designed cross-cultural programming for NC State University, worked on water advocacy rights with indigenous populations in South India and co-founded a social enterprise in West Africa.

She holds three degrees from NC State University, including a Masters of International Studies with a specialization in Rural Development.

Through all of her work, Kristine has seen the transformative power of self-aware, mature leadership, and she’s absolutely thrilled to bring her experience and vision to the Leadership Triangle community.

Terrance Ruth, PhD

Leadership Triangle Facilitator

Dr. Ruth has been an advocate for public education, serving as a teacher, principal and the parent of a son who attends public schools in Wake County. He served as the NC NAACP Executive Director under Dr. Barber and Dr. Spearman and has served as National Director of Programming for the Repairers of the Breach. Recently he partnered with United Way of the Triangle to launch a community investment fund for local community organizers.

 

Currently, Terrance is a Professor at NCSU and is the former President of the Justice Love Foundation. He is deeply engaged in diversity, equity and inclusion work across the city of Raleigh and the Triangle.

 

Dr. Terrance Ruth received his PhD in Public Affairs from the University of Central Florida. He received his Master in Education from Nova Southeastern University and his BA from Oglethorpe University. Dr. Ruth completed a national fellowship through Boston College with a certification in nonprofit leadership.
